SEX, SOUL AND ISLAM tells a story of an unlikely alliance between two opposite elements of the human experience – the carnal and the spiritual. The sexual instinct could potentially spoil the soul’s quest for paradise. Instead, they become companions when a believer embraces Islam’s revelations on the sex-soul connection. This fascinating title situates sex in its worldview of life, revisits the spirit behind the letter of its sexual laws, and describes how paradises on earth can thrive – where lovers may dwell in tranquillity, love and mercy. Along the way, it explains how marriage anchors this alliance, reframes a prevalently male-serving view of conjugal rights and reintroduces sensual pleasuring as the underlying theme behind the Islamic outlook on lovemaking. The authors explain how classical Islamic perspective regarding sex might navigate pornography, oral sex, sex toys, fantasy roleplay and BDSM, among other – using insights from the social sciences, sexual therapy and the writers’ own counselling experience. Islam and The English Enlightenment
In his latest book, Dr Zulfiqar traces the influence of Islamic ideology on western culture. Sitting down with Remona Aly, he shares his passion for the history of the Enlightenment period – and how this interest came about. After his father found him studying the bible, Dr Zulfiqar was introduced to a professor of Islamic history. “He said that Islam had its golden age, and without Islam there would be no America or England, and without the Islamic philosophy or theology there would have been no reformation; no enlightenment.” During those early years at college, Dr Zulfiqar began to unravel the ways that Islamic ideology was absorbed into different European cultures during the periods leading up to the 17th century enlightenment.
